avendo una variabile che recupero:
id=request.querystring("id")
e sapendo che id è un numero posso trasformarla effettivamente in un numero al posto di una stringa???
avendo una variabile che recupero:
id=request.querystring("id")
e sapendo che id è un numero posso trasformarla effettivamente in un numero al posto di una stringa???
Funzione CInt
Restituisce un'espressione che è stata convertita in un valore Variant del sottotipo Integer.
CInt(espressione)
L'argomento espressione può essere rappresentato da una qualsiasi espressione valida.
Osservazioni
Pesa più un litro d'acqua o uno d'olio...?
La prima persona al mondo a finire Splinter Cell uccidendo solo una persona. Già che c'ero l'ho fatto anche in Splinter Cell 2: solo 5 UCCISIONI
.*zerOKilled*.
certo che puoi. peccato che ASP gestisca solo Variant!
id=Cint(id)
Pesa più un litro d'acqua o uno d'olio...?
La prima persona al mondo a finire Splinter Cell uccidendo solo una persona. Già che c'ero l'ho fatto anche in Splinter Cell 2: solo 5 UCCISIONI
.*zerOKilled*.
se sei sicuro che in querystring gli arriva perforza un valore numerico non servono i 2 controlli e basta id = CInt(Request("id"))codice:if IsNumeric(Request.QueryString("id")) then id=Cint(request.querystring("id"))
Robycodice:id = request.querystring("id") if id <> "" and not IsNull(id) then id = CInt(id) end if
www.creamweb.it [v. 3.0]
:: Script ASP!
:: Web directory gratuita!
:: Campioni del mondo!
OK, grazie mille, con CInt funziona benissimo!
![]()